华为云国际站注册:JDBC数据库配置MySQL数据库实战指南
一、华为云MySQL数据库的核心优势
华为云MySQL数据库服务凭借以下特性成为企业级应用的首选:
- 高可用架构 – 采用主备复制与跨AZ部署,保障99.95%的服务可用性
- 弹性扩展 – 支持分钟级存储扩容和读写分离,轻松应对业务峰值
- 数据安全 – 提供自动备份、SSL加密及VPC网络隔离三重防护
- 全球部署 – 依托华为云国际站节点实现低延迟跨境访问
例如华为云HECS云服务器搭配RDS MySQL实例,可构建高性能Web应用架构。
二、JDBC连接MySQL的配置流程
1. 华为云数据库准备阶段
- 登录华为云国际站控制台(https://www.huaweicloud.com/intl/)
- 在RDS服务中创建MySQL实例,记录实例连接地址
- 配置安全组规则放行3306端口
- 创建数据库账号并授权(建议使用最小权限原则)
2. JDBC连接配置详解
// JDBC连接字符串示例
String url = "jdbc:mysql://{rds_endpoint}:3306/{db_name}?useSSL=true&serverTimezone=UTC";
Properties connProps = new Properties();
connProps.put("user", "your_username");
connProps.put("password", "your_password");
关键参数说明:
| 参数 | 说明 |
|---|---|
| useSSL | 启用华为云提供的SSL证书加密传输 |
| connectTimeout | 建议设置为5秒(5000ms) |
| autoReconnect | 建议开启自动重连机制 |
三、华为云配套产品推荐
1. 弹性云服务器ECS
推荐配置:
- 通用计算增强型c6(4vCPUs/8GB)
- 搭配100GB超高IO云硬盘
- 绑定弹性公网IP实现稳定访问
2. 云数据库RDS for MySQL
优势特性:
- 支持5.7/8.0主流版本
- 最大支持128TB存储空间
- 提供慢查询分析和性能监控
四、最佳实践与故障排查
性能优化建议
- 使用华为云数据库智能运维DAS进行索引优化
- JDBC连接池配置建议:
maxActive=50, maxWait=10000, minIdle=10
常见错误解决方案
| 错误代码 | 原因分析 | 解决方案 |
|---|---|---|
| 1045 | 账号权限不足 | 检查华为云RDS白名单设置 |
| 2003 | 网络不通 | 验证安全组规则和VPC配置 |
五、总结
本文详细介绍了在华为云国际站环境下通过JDBC连接MySQL数据库的完整方案。华为云凭借其全球化的基础设施布局、企业级的数据库服务以及完善的生态产品(如ECS、RDS、DAS等),为用户提供了:

- 简单易用的控制台管理界面
- 高性能的数据库读写能力
- 军工级的数据安全保障
- 跨地域的部署灵活性
建议企业用户选择华为云RDS for MySQL搭配弹性云服务器构建应用系统,可获得最优的性价比和稳定性。
发布者:luotuoemo,转转请注明出处:https://www.jintuiyun.com/441599.html